Printing Planet UK is a full-service printing provider based in Putney Heath, London. It primarily serves local individuals, businesses, schools, sports teams, and small brands, offering services such as same-day T-shirt printing, garment embroidery, DTG/DTF/heat transfer/vinyl printing, business cards, flyers, banners, stickers, binding, gifts, and graphic design. It is closer to a “physical print workshop + UK delivery” fulfillment supplier than a POD platform with APIs or ecommerce store integrations.
Its garment production options are fairly comprehensive: DTG is suitable for 100% cotton and photo-quality full-color designs; DTF is aimed at polyester, sportswear, hi-vis garments, and waterproof jackets; vinyl works well for team numbers and one- or two-color logos; embroidery is used for more wash-resistant corporate uniforms such as polos, hats, and workwear. The service supports orders from just 1 piece, with no minimum order quantity, and can also provide retail finishing such as neck labels, woven labels, wash labels, and hang tags. Its supply chain also includes blank T-shirts, hoodies, polos, and workwear, with brands mentioned including Fruit of the Loom, Stanley Stella, Gildan, and AWDis.
The website discloses some reference pricing: DTG chest prints on light-colored garments cost £12 per piece for 1–5 items, dropping to £6.50 per piece for 100+; dark-colored garments cost £15 per piece for 1–5 items and £8 per piece for 100+. Embroidery starts from £2.75 per piece, new logo digitization costs £20, and the digitization fee is waived for orders over 50 pieces. Graphic design starts from £35. The same-day service rules for small orders are clear: submit print-ready files before 11am and collect by 5pm, up to 15 T-shirts or 250 business cards, with no rush fee. Standard orders generally take 3–7 working days, while large orders take 7–14 days. Tracked courier delivery is available across the UK.
The advantages are that it is friendly to small orders, offers a wide range of production methods, has a physical store where customers can walk in to view samples and consult staff, and same-day delivery is highly valuable for last-minute events. The downsides are that many complex orders still require a custom quote; business hours are weekdays only; the service area is mainly the UK; and there is no visible information on Shopify, Etsy, API, automated dropshipping, or other ecommerce integrations, so it is not suitable as a global cross-border POD backend.
It is suitable for apparel brands operating in the UK, corporate uniform buyers, school clubs, sports clubs, and small businesses that need fast sampling.
